Subject: Cron-to-Windmere cut-over summary

Hello plugin authors — as of this morning, all scheduled jobs on the Larkspur platform have been migrated from host-level cron to the Windmere workflow engine. Legacy crontabs have been disabled but preserved for thirty days. Plugins registering scheduled tasks must now declare them via the Windmere manifest; direct cron registration will be rejected. The engine settings your plugins will run under are the following.

settings of kahag-bagug:
[quenath]
port = 6379
region = outer-2
host = quenath.nelvrocorp.internal
timeout_ms = 2000
retries = 3

Our Q3 projection shows net operating inflows of 4.2m, a modest improvement over Q2 driven by earlier collections from the Tarrow Logistics account. Receivables ageing has tightened to 38 days on average. Outflows remain stable, though the Halden warehouse refit will front-load roughly 600k into July. Please review the variance assumptions in the attached workbook before Friday's close. Contingency buffers remain at 8% of projected inflows. The following note outlines the strategic rationale behind these figures.

board note of baweg-bawig: Project Tamath slips by six weeks because of the audit delay.

## Releases

DigestWheel schedules batch email digests for the Quillhaven suite. Releases cut every Tuesday. Version bump in `release.toml`, tag, push. CI builds, tests, signs, publishes to the internal feed. Do not publish manually. Hotfixes: branch from the latest tag, same pipeline, no shortcuts. Rollbacks use the previous signed artifact only — never rebuild an old tag. Contractors get publish access after the first reviewed release. All artifacts must verify before deploy; verification uses the signing key below.

deploy key for kajof-yawif: bky9_fvxrpdHPq

**Action item: tune the replica-lag alarm (owner: Priya on the Marlowe team)**

Quick recap for release planning: the read-replica lag alarm on the Fennwick cluster fired twelve times last sprint, and eleven were noise. The threshold was copied from the old Dovetail setup and never revisited. We agreed to raise the lag ceiling, add a sustained-duration check, and widen the evaluation window so blips don't page anyone. Here are the revised constants we'll ship with the next release train:

tuning table, yajog-yahof:
BUDGETS = {
    "lamvan": 303,
    "wenox": 460,
    "fenvan": 525,
}